CBSE Board Exam Result 2023: If you are good in these subjects, you should choose Arts

If Science and Accounting is not your calling, Arts may be the best-suited stream for you. Fine arts, graphic design, music, writing, and other creative fields are just a few examples of the many varied and rewarding careers in the Arts. 

Although “Humanities” and “Arts” are frequently used interchangeably, their meanings can vary based on the situation. The expression of human ingenuity and imagination through visible or performing arts, such as painting, sculpture, music, dance, or theatre, is referred to as the “Arts”. Humanities, conversely, pertains to the academic fields of literature, philosophy, history, and languages that study human culture, thought, and expression. It is important to remember that there can be substantial overlap and interdisciplinary connections between the Arts and Humanities and that the lines dividing them are not always clearly defined.

There are a number of topics that a student should be interested in if they plan to study the Arts:

– Visual Arts: A foundational topic in the arts stream, visual arts encompasses a variety of artistic mediums, including painting, drawing, sculpture, printmaking, and photography. Students with a love for the visual arts should have an eye for detail, the capacity for creative thought, and an eye for aesthetic expression.

– Performing Arts: Subjects in the performing arts, like music, dance, and theatre, are also crucial parts of the arts stream. Students interested in performing arts should feel at ease expressing themselves on stage, have a talent for music, rhythm, and dance, and be able to work cooperatively with others.

– Literature and creative writing: Students interested in a writing, journalism, or publishing job may find it useful to take literature and creative writing courses. These topics can promote creativity, improve writing abilities, and give students a better grasp of literary genres and techniques.

– Art history: For students interested in the visual arts, art history is crucial because it explains the societal and historical context of various art movements and styles.

– Graphic Design: Since it is a talent that is highly marketable across many industries, graphic design is a subject that is becoming increasingly popular in the arts stream. Students interested in graphic design should have a keen sense of aesthetics and be able to use a variety of software applications.

The humanities include disciplines such as history, logic, linguistics, literature, religion, and anthropology, though the arts also address these topics. The Arts are, therefore, a subset of the disciplines.

One’s academic aptitude should not be the only factor considered when deciding whether to follow the Arts. Before making a choice, it is crucial to consider a student’s interests, passions, career objectives, and general aptitude for a given topic or field.
